    I pretty much maxed out my order leaving my price at about $2470. I ended up calling up because I needed it shipped to an APO box and after all the discounts they give over the phone, it ended up running me just under $2100. The university discount is pretty nice if you qualify.

    The Bench specs at http://www.notebookreview.com/default.asp?newsID=3787 put this laptop equal performance with the Geforce 7600 video card with it's 8400...nice...putting this pretty much as the best small size laptop out there. The only other choices is by going to a 14" and finding a 8600. If you go 15 inch...you'll be able to go for that 8800 or 8900 very shortly.

    I also like the slot loading drive...no more accidental disk ejections :)

    No, there a .0000001 chance that will happen, :p

    For < 15", the most common card will the the 8400M GT or less.
    For 15.4, it will be the 8600M GT.
    For > 17", it will be the 8700M and the 8800.

    I don't know how you even got the notion that the 8900 will be available....even "shortly"

    To be more correct :) the 7700 is installed on a few laptops that are 15" out there...bit hard to find them but they're out there...ASUS G1-AK024C is one of them. You can modify a 15" dell computer with a 7800...but that's beyond a 15" actually supporting one.

    The Znote 6324W is a 14" and has a 8600...not a common laptop, just powerful.

    Provided that the cards are similar in size per hundreds generation, you might see a 8700 in a 15 inch, but if there's too much heat or it is actually larger...that may never happen like you said.

    8800...I'll just agree with you that we may not see that one unless by chance some company custom builds it into the laptop. I see that around Okinawa where I live currently with 15" laptops with 7900 built in...they're just way to expensive and from one of my co workers who owns one...goes through the battery like there's no tomorrow.

    as for the 8900...there's no way to tell when that will come out...maybe nVidia will release it before they even get their drivers fully vista functional like the did releasing the 8800 with no video drivers.

    Anyhow...hopefully we'll see some nicer ATI cards in the future...I'm sick of nVidia's cards doing the horizontal tearing under every condition, every program, ever version of windows,under every card I have ever owned, even with vsync on....that's piss poor quality.

    As for the phone price...it seems like their pricing is totally different than online. The guy I spoke with totaled it and I looked a gift horse in the mouth and asked. We went through the config and the prices were just different so oh well. I priced mine with the 6% discount /w 1 year coverage and 12% with 3 and the 1 year was still cheaper by about $90. On the phone, the 3 year was cheaper by $7.
